Understanding the basics of lightweight web browsers

Key Features of Lightweight Web Browsers

Lightweight web browsers are designed with simplicity and efficiency in mind. Unlike their heavyweight counterparts, these browsers focus on core functionalities while minimizing resource consumption. Here are some of their standout features:

  • Minimal Resource Usage: Lightweight browsers are optimized to use less CPU, RAM, and storage, making them ideal for older devices or systems with limited resources.
  • Fast Loading Speeds: By stripping away unnecessary features and focusing on essential tasks, these browsers often load web pages faster than traditional browsers.
  • Customizability: Many lightweight browsers allow users to tailor their experience by enabling or disabling specific features, ensuring a personalized browsing experience.
  • Privacy-Focused: Some lightweight browsers prioritize user privacy by blocking trackers, ads, and cookies by default.
  • Portable Versions: Many lightweight browsers offer portable versions that can be run directly from a USB drive without installation.
  • Compatibility with Older Systems: These browsers are often designed to work seamlessly on older operating systems that no longer support mainstream browsers.

How Lightweight Web Browsers Compare to Alternatives

When compared to mainstream browsers, lightweight web browsers stand out in several key areas:

  • Performance: Lightweight browsers are faster and more responsive, especially on low-powered devices.
  • Resource Efficiency: They consume significantly less memory and processing power, making them ideal for multitasking or running on older hardware.
  • Feature Set: While they may lack some advanced features like extensive extensions or developer tools, they excel in delivering a clutter-free browsing experience.
  • Privacy: Many lightweight browsers come with built-in privacy features, whereas mainstream browsers often require additional extensions for similar functionality.
  • User Base: Lightweight browsers cater to a niche audience, including professionals, developers, and users with specific needs, whereas mainstream browsers aim for mass appeal.

Benefits of using lightweight web browsers

Improved Security and Privacy

One of the most compelling reasons to switch to a lightweight web browser is the enhanced security and privacy they offer. Here’s how they achieve this:

  • Ad and Tracker Blocking: Many lightweight browsers come with built-in ad blockers and anti-tracking features, reducing the risk of data collection and intrusive ads.
  • Minimal Data Collection: Unlike mainstream browsers that often collect user data for analytics or advertising, lightweight browsers typically adopt a no-logs policy.
  • Fewer Vulnerabilities: With fewer features and extensions, lightweight browsers present a smaller attack surface for hackers.
  • HTTPS Enforcement: Some lightweight browsers automatically redirect users to secure HTTPS versions of websites, ensuring safer browsing.

Enhanced User Experience

Lightweight web browsers are designed to prioritize user experience. Here’s how they achieve this:

  • Faster Page Loads: By eliminating unnecessary features, these browsers deliver quicker load times, even on slower internet connections.
  • Simplified Interface: A clean, intuitive interface ensures that users can navigate effortlessly without distractions.
  • Reduced System Strain: With lower resource consumption, lightweight browsers allow for smoother multitasking and extended battery life on laptops and mobile devices.
  • Customizable Settings: Users can tailor their browsing experience to suit their preferences, from disabling animations to enabling dark mode.

Common challenges with lightweight web browsers

Performance Issues and Solutions

While lightweight browsers are designed for efficiency, they can encounter performance issues under certain conditions. Here’s a breakdown of common problems and their solutions:

  • Slow Rendering on Complex Websites: Some lightweight browsers struggle with modern, resource-intensive websites. Solution: Use a browser that supports modern web standards like HTML5 and CSS3.
  • Limited Extension Support: Many lightweight browsers lack extensive extension libraries. Solution: Opt for browsers that support essential extensions or offer built-in alternatives.
  • Occasional Crashes: Lightweight browsers may crash when handling large files or multiple tabs. Solution: Limit the number of open tabs and clear the browser cache regularly.

Compatibility Concerns

Compatibility is another challenge for lightweight web browsers. Here’s what users might face and how to address it:

  • Incompatibility with Modern Websites: Some lightweight browsers may not render modern websites correctly. Solution: Use a secondary browser for such sites.
  • Limited OS Support: While many lightweight browsers are designed for older systems, they may not support the latest operating systems. Solution: Check compatibility before installation.
  • Restricted Media Playback: Certain lightweight browsers may lack support for advanced media codecs. Solution: Install necessary plugins or use an alternative browser for media-heavy tasks.

Examples of lightweight web browsers

Example 1: Midori

Midori is a lightweight, open-source browser known for its speed and simplicity. It offers a clean interface, built-in ad blocker, and support for HTML5.

Example 2: Falkon

Falkon is a KDE-based lightweight browser that combines speed with essential features like tab management and a built-in RSS reader.

Example 3: Lynx

Lynx is a text-based browser ideal for users who prioritize speed and privacy. It’s perfect for low-powered systems and command-line enthusiasts.
